David Fincher seems to be moving forward on 20th Century Fox’s Gone Girl, based on the bestselling novel by Gillian Flynn. The studio has been developing the project with Fincher since January.
The story centers on a woman who disappears on the day of her fifth wedding anniversary, and all signs point to her husband as the killer. Although Reese Witherspoon is on board to produce, Deadline says she won’t be starring in the film. But considering Fincher’s track record, the studio will likely have little trouble in finding a leading lady.
